Enola Holmes, the much younger sister of Sherlock and Mycroft, owns a building in the heart of 19th-century London, a place she uses under pseudonyms to front for her investigative work. Employed there is a porter, Joddy, a young boy in a uniform festooned with buttons, whose even younger brother substitutes for him when he's sick. But, Paddy disappears...

The Nightjar by Deborah Hewitt is a stunning contemporary fantasy debut about another London, a magical world hidden behind the bustling modern city we know.
Alice Wyndham has been plagued by visions of birds her whole life...until the mysterious Crowley reveals that Alice is an 'aviarist': capable of seeing nightjars, magical birds that guard human souls. When her best friend is hit by a car, only Alice can find and save her nightjar.
